Resumo: Using resources from Ginga (ABNT NBR 15806-2, 2007) in a program for interactive television, eductional broadcasters can send semantic metadata and objects of teaching and learning directly in the stream digital television braadcasting. The average range of a typical digital transmitter that segment can achieve an area of up to twently-four square miles (FORUM SBTVD, 2008, 2010) reaching the outskirts of urban macro-zones in residential areas without internet access and schools unmet by PNBL (National Broadband Plan, Minicom, 2012). Since January 2014, 90% of television sets manufactured in Brazil have Ginga shipped and are connectable to networks of informational devices (ACT nº 140, BRAZIL, 2013), and become strategic in this new reality brought about by digital and media convergence. Educational broadcasters can offer programming on demand applications, ontologies of learning objects content and games that allow two-way communication and offer of learning content to television flow as knowledge representation language. This research evaluates the technical and educational viability of new ways of learning and scientific dissemination through a media device that achieves immense capillary nationwide and used by 97% of Brazilians every day of the week in all age groups and social stratum (BRAZIL, 2015)
